After two powerful earthquakes hit Venezuela, ADRA is focusing its emergency response on water, sanitation and hygiene. Local teams are distributing personal hygiene kits, helping secure access to clean water, and preparing food assistance. Donations will support families affected by damaged homes, disrupted services, and unsafe living conditions.
The earthquakes damaged homes, public buildings, hospitals, schools, and basic infrastructure. Many families have lost safe shelter and access to essential services. Clean water, sanitation and hygiene are urgent priorities, as disrupted systems increase health risks. Response efforts are also complicated by unsafe rubble and possible asbestos exposure.
ADRA's response focuses mainly on the WASH sector: water, sanitation and hygiene. Local teams are distributing personal hygiene kits, supporting access to clean water, and assessing further needs in affected communities. Planned assistance also includes food support, while ADRA continues adapting its response to urgent needs on the ground.
This will help reduce health risks and restore dignity for families affected by the earthquakes. Access to clean water, hygiene supplies and basic assistance can prevent further suffering in the first phase of the crisis. Longer-term support can help communities recover, rebuild safer routines, and regain access to essential services.
